(a) what is the magnitude of the momentum of a 11000-kg truck whose speed is 10 m/s?

Given: Mass m = 11,000 Kg;   V = 10 m/s

Required: Momentum P = ?

Formula: P = mV

               P = (11,000 Kg)(10 m/s)

               P = 110,000 Kg-m/s
